Special Issue Information

Dear Colleagues,

This Special Issue focuses on four separate elements: First, the growth, metabolism, and biochemical regulation methods of algae in raw water. Second, the mechanisms of oxidative stress in algae induced by stress conditions, such as oxidative stress, high temperature, UV irradiation, nutrient deprivation, and salinity imbalance, etc. Finally, the control of algal organic matter release and enhanced algae removal.

The content of this Special Issue is not limited to the above-mentioned areas, but any innovative full-length articles, reviews, and commentaries that can help improve the safe removal and secondary pollution control of algae in raw water are very welcome.
